Craft Roundup: It’s All in the Bag

You can never have enough bags! When it comes to summer activities – heading off to day camp, long weekend visits to see family or a quick trip to the beach – you’ll need a fun bag to pack all your goodies in. You can make a bag from scratch or add your own creative touches to a plain, ready-to-decorate tote found at the craft store in the clothing aisle. Check out this week’s Make It roundup for some bagable inspiration.

 

DIY Printed Tote Bag Using the Sun

Let Mother Nature do the work for you with this cool design from How About Orange. The special ink used actually develops its color in the sun as it dries – pretty neat!

 

No-Sew Jambox Tote Bag

No sewing skills are needed to enjoy your favorite songs, thanks to this tote project from Brit + Co.

 

Easy Drawstring Backpack Tutorial

The anchor on this simple backpack from PinkWhen is perfect for summer adventures. How will you decorate yours?

 

DIY Quote Tee

I bet many of you have some simple alphabet stencils in your art boxes. Taking a cue from this DIY quote T-shirt on Flo’s Beauty: Fashion, Hair and Makeup, have your young crafters stencil a favorite word on a plain tote bag for quick personalization.
